Tour Gastronómico de Cork





Descripción
Descubre Cork, conocida como la 'Ciudad de las Mil Bienvenidas', con nuestros experimentados guías locales que comparten su pasión y conocimiento sobre esta querida ciudad. Este tour lo llevará a través del famoso mercado de alimentos y bebidas de Cork, el Mercado Inglés, que ha estado operando desde el siglo XVIII. Los huéspedes tendrán la oportunidad de reunirse y charlar con los comerciantes locales, añadiendo un poco de diversión y "locura" a la experiencia. El tour destaca lo mejor que Cork tiene para ofrecer, incluyendo degustaciones reservadas de galardonados quesos locales, deliciosos mariscos recién salidos del Atlántico, deliciosos pasteles de carne, salchichas gourmet del país y mucho más, todo bajo los auspicios de su guía local y amable.

Itinerario
Los huéspedes pueden disfrutar de un plato de queso con una cerveza local
Aprende sobre la herencia de Cork y su tradición de larga data como capital de la comida mientras deambulas por los callejones y calles de la ciudad
Ingrese a esta magnífica iglesia del siglo XIX, diseñada por el arquitecto Pugin de renombre mundial, con sus impresionantes ángeles tallados y pilares de mármol.
Descubre el corazón de la escena culinaria de Cork. Chatea con proveedores y vendedores locales mientras degustas lo mejor de mariscos irlandeses, salchichas gourmet, deliciosos pasteles y mucho más.
Entre en un pub que data de mediados del siglo XVIII, lleno de historia e historias, y disfrute de un café irlandés cremoso y acogedor.
Ningún tour está completo sin una visita al chocolatero local, especialmente para chocolates hechos de la crema de hermosas vacas irlandesas!
